数据库资源指的是什么意思
-
数据库资源指的是数据库系统中存储的各种数据和相关的资源。数据库系统是一个存储、管理和操作数据的软件系统,它通过使用不同的数据模型和数据结构来组织和管理数据。数据库资源包括但不限于以下几个方面:
-
数据表:数据库中的数据以表的形式进行组织和存储。每个表包含多个列和行,每一列代表一个数据字段,每一行代表一个数据记录。数据表是数据库中最基本的资源之一。
-
索引:索引是一种数据结构,用于提高数据检索的效率。通过创建索引,可以快速地定位到指定的数据记录,而不需要遍历整个数据表。索引可以基于一个或多个列来创建。
-
视图:视图是从一个或多个数据表中导出的虚拟表。它是一个逻辑上的表,不存储实际的数据。通过创建视图,可以根据需要从多个表中选择、过滤和组合数据,简化复杂的查询操作。
-
存储过程:存储过程是一段预先编译好的SQL代码,可以在数据库中进行存储和重复使用。存储过程可以接受参数,执行一系列的SQL语句,并返回结果。通过使用存储过程,可以提高数据库的性能和安全性。
-
触发器:触发器是与表相关联的一段代码,可以在插入、更新或删除数据时自动触发执行。触发器可以用于实现数据的自动化处理和约束,例如在插入数据时自动计算某个字段的值,或在删除数据时进行相关的操作。
总之,数据库资源是数据库系统中存储的各种数据和相关的资源,包括数据表、索引、视图、存储过程和触发器等。这些资源可以帮助用户有效地组织、管理和操作数据库中的数据。
1年前 -
-
数据库资源是指存储在数据库中的各种数据和相关的资源。数据库是一个用于存储和管理数据的系统,其中包含了各种不同类型的数据,例如文本、数字、图像、音频、视频等。这些数据可以被组织、存储、检索和处理,以满足用户的需求。
数据库资源可以包括以下几个方面:
-
数据表:数据表是数据库中最基本的资源,它是由一系列的行和列组成的二维表格。每个数据表都有一个特定的名称,用于存储相关的数据。例如,一个学生信息管理系统可以有一个名为"students"的数据表,用于存储学生的个人信息。
-
数据字段:数据字段是数据表中的列,用于存储特定类型的数据。每个字段都有一个名称和数据类型,用于定义数据的结构和属性。例如,在上述的"students"数据表中,可以有字段包括"学号"、"姓名"、"性别"、"年龄"等。
-
数据记录:数据记录是数据表中的行,代表一个具体的数据实例。每个数据记录都包含了一组字段的值,用于描述该实例的属性。例如,在"students"数据表中,每一行代表一个具体的学生,包含了该学生的学号、姓名、性别、年龄等信息。
-
数据索引:数据索引是数据库中用于加快数据检索速度的数据结构。它可以根据某个字段的值进行排序和组织数据,以便快速定位和访问所需的数据。例如,在"students"数据表中,可以为学号字段创建一个索引,以便根据学号快速查找学生的信息。
-
视图:视图是基于一个或多个数据表的查询结果,用于简化数据访问和操作。它可以将多个数据表的数据整合在一起,并提供一个虚拟的表格供用户使用。例如,可以创建一个名为"student_info"的视图,包含了"students"数据表中学生的学号、姓名和班级信息。
-
存储过程和触发器:存储过程是一段预定义的代码逻辑,用于执行特定的任务或操作。触发器是与数据库操作相关的一种特殊的存储过程,它会在特定的事件发生时自动触发执行。存储过程和触发器可以用于实现复杂的业务逻辑和数据处理。
-
数据库连接和权限:数据库资源还包括数据库连接和权限,用于控制用户对数据库的访问和操作。数据库连接是指建立应用程序和数据库之间的连接通道,用于传输数据和执行操作。权限是指用户对数据库资源的操作权限,包括读取、写入、修改、删除等。数据库管理员可以根据用户的角色和需求,分配不同的权限。
总之,数据库资源是指存储在数据库中的各种数据和相关的资源,包括数据表、数据字段、数据记录、数据索引、视图、存储过程和触发器、数据库连接和权限等。这些资源可以被组织、存储、检索和处理,以满足用户的需求。
1年前 -
-
数据库资源是指数据库管理系统(DBMS)中的各种资源,包括但不限于数据文件、表空间、表、索引、视图、存储过程、触发器等。这些资源是用于存储和管理数据的基本组成部分,可以被用户和应用程序访问和操作。
数据库资源的意义在于提供了数据存储和管理的基础设施,使得用户和应用程序可以方便地存储、检索、更新和删除数据。数据库资源的合理使用和管理对于数据库系统的性能和可靠性至关重要。
下面将从方法、操作流程等方面详细讲解数据库资源的内容。
一、数据库资源的分类
-
数据文件:是数据库中存储数据的物理文件,包括数据表、索引、视图等。数据文件通常以磁盘文件的形式存在,可以存储在本地磁盘上,也可以存储在网络存储设备上。
-
表空间:是一种逻辑概念,用于组织和管理数据文件。一个数据库可以包含多个表空间,每个表空间可以包含一个或多个数据文件。表空间提供了对数据文件的统一管理,可以方便地进行备份、恢复、扩展和压缩等操作。
-
表:是数据库中存储数据的基本单位,由一组有序的列组成。表可以用于存储结构化数据,例如员工信息、订单信息等。用户可以通过SQL语句对表进行增删改查操作。
-
索引:是一种数据结构,用于加速数据的检索。索引可以基于表的一个或多个列创建,可以提高查询性能。常见的索引类型包括B树索引、哈希索引、全文索引等。
-
视图:是一个虚拟的表,由一个或多个基本表的数据组成。视图可以简化复杂的查询操作,提供了一种逻辑上的数据模型。用户可以通过视图访问和操作基本表的数据。
-
存储过程:是一段预先编译的代码,可以在数据库中存储和执行。存储过程可以接收参数,执行一系列的SQL语句,并返回结果。存储过程常用于完成复杂的业务逻辑,提高数据库的性能和安全性。
-
触发器:是一段与表相关联的代码,可以在表上的数据发生变化时自动触发执行。触发器可以用于实现数据的约束和业务逻辑的处理,例如在插入数据时自动计算某个字段的值。
二、数据库资源的使用方法
-
创建和管理数据库资源:可以使用数据库管理工具(如MySQL Workbench、SQL Server Management Studio等)或命令行工具(如MySQL命令行客户端、SQL Server命令行工具等)来创建和管理数据库资源。通过这些工具,可以创建数据库、创建表空间、创建表、创建索引、创建视图、创建存储过程、创建触发器等。
-
访问和操作数据库资源:可以使用SQL语句来访问和操作数据库资源。常用的SQL语句包括SELECT、INSERT、UPDATE、DELETE等,可以用于查询数据、插入数据、更新数据和删除数据等操作。
-
优化数据库资源的性能:可以通过调整数据库的参数和优化SQL语句来提高数据库资源的性能。例如,可以通过适当调整数据库缓冲区大小、优化查询语句的索引使用、使用合适的存储引擎等方式来提高数据库的查询性能。
-
备份和恢复数据库资源:数据库资源的备份和恢复是保证数据库安全和可靠性的重要手段。可以通过数据库管理工具或命令行工具来进行数据库的备份和恢复操作。备份可以将数据库资源的数据和结构保存到一个文件中,以便在需要时进行恢复。
-
监控和管理数据库资源:可以使用数据库管理工具或命令行工具来监控和管理数据库资源。通过这些工具,可以查看数据库资源的使用情况、查看数据库的性能指标、查看数据库的日志信息等。根据监控结果,可以及时发现和解决数据库资源的问题,保证数据库的正常运行。
总结:数据库资源是数据库管理系统中的各种资源,包括数据文件、表空间、表、索引、视图、存储过程、触发器等。合理使用和管理数据库资源对于数据库系统的性能和可靠性至关重要。通过创建和管理数据库资源、访问和操作数据库资源、优化数据库资源的性能、备份和恢复数据库资源、监控和管理数据库资源等方法,可以有效地管理和利用数据库资源。
1年前 -